Key Largo is stunning from the surface, surrounded by sparkling water and offering breathtaking views as far as the eye can see. But the real magic lies beneath the surface, where an abundance of wildlife and coral reefs thrive. Florida Keys National Marine Sanctuary protects 3,800 square miles of water surrounding the Keys, and it’s home to North America’s only coral barrier reef as well as seagrass beds, mangrove-fringed islands, and more than 6,000 species of marine life.
In addition to this important sanctuary, you can’t miss a visit to John Pennekamp Coral Reef State Park, where you can find more coral reefs and mangrove swamps that attract travelers from all over the world.
